Dos of Typography



To enhance the readability and aesthetic appeal of your website, make certain that you select font styles that are easy to check out and suitably sized. Pick fonts that are clear and readable, such as sans-serif or serif typefaces, which are frequently used for body text. Sans-serif font styles like Arial or Helvetica work well for electronic displays, offering a contemporary and tidy look. On the other hand, serif font styles like Times New Roman or Georgia can include a touch of elegance and practice to your internet site.

An additional important facet to consider is font sizing. Make sure your text is huge sufficient to be checked out pleasantly without stressing the eyes. Select a font style size of at the very least 16px for body message to make sure readability. Additionally, utilize different typeface dimensions to develop an aesthetic pecking order on your website. Headings and subheadings should be bigger and bolder than the body message, directing the reader through the material effortlessly.
